Overview
The Canon 1D Mark II N is a professional-grade DSLR camera introduced in 2005, part of the renowned EOS-1D series. It features an 8.2-megapixel APS-H size CMOS sensor providing high-resolution images. The camera offers a 5 frames per second continuous shooting speed suitable for fast-action photography. Its 45-point autofocus system ensures precision focusing in diverse shooting scenarios. The DIGIC II image processor enhances image quality and camera response time. Additionally, it supports ISO sensitivity from 100 to 1600, expandable to 3200 for low-light conditions.

Key Advantages
The 1D Mark II N excels with a robust build quality ideal for professional use in challenging environments. Its fast and accurate autofocus system allows capturing sharp images even in motion. The DIGIC II processor delivers quick startup times and minimal shutter lag. High-speed continuous shooting supports action and sports photography effectively. The camera is compatible with a wide range of Canon EF lenses. It offers excellent image quality with good noise control at higher ISO settings.
Limitations
The 8.2-megapixel resolution, while good at the time, is modest compared to modern DSLR cameras. The APS-H sensor size is smaller than full-frame, which may affect depth of field and wide-angle performance. The LCD screen resolution is relatively low by today’s standards. Video recording is not supported in this model. The camera’s weight and size may be less convenient for casual photographers. Battery life, while adequate, is outperformed by newer models with advanced power management.
